LITHUANIA JOINS THE SCHENGEN AREA
The Council of the European Union confirmed at its meeting on 6 December 2007 that Lithuania, Latvia, Estonia, the Czeck Republic, Hungary, Malta, Slovenia, Poland and Slovakia become a part of the Schengen Area and will start full implementation of the Schengen acquis from 21 December 2007.
The membership in the Schengen Area is a major achievement of Lithuanian internal and foreign policy. Inter alia, it significantly changes procedure of application for visas to enter Lithuania.
